itgle.com
更多“由于MCS-51的串行口的数据发送和接收缓冲器都是SBUF,所以其串行口不能同时发送和接收数据,即不是全双工的串行口。”相关问题
  • 第1题:

    由于MCS-51的串行口的数据发送和接收缓冲器都是SBUF,所以其串行口不能同时发送和接收数据,即不是全双工的串行口。()

    此题为判断题(对,错)。


    正确答案:错误

  • 第2题:

    全双工以太网传输技术的特点是()

    A.能同时发送和接收数据,不受CSMA/CD限制

    B.能同时发送和接收数据,受CSMA/CD限制

    C.不能同时发送和接收数据,不受CSMA/CD限制

    D.不能同时发送和接收数据,受CSMA/CD限制


    正确答案:A

  • 第3题:

    MCS-51单片机串行数据缓冲器SBUF的主要作用是()。

    • A、存放待发送或已接收到的数据
    • B、只存放待发送的数据
    • C、存放控制字
    • D、只存放已接收到的数据

    正确答案:A

  • 第4题:

    MCS-51单片机串行口发送/接收中断源的工作过程是:当串行口接收或发送完一帧数据时,将SCON中的(),向CPU申请中断。

    • A、RI或TI置1
    • B、RI或TI置0
    • C、RI置1或TI置0
    • D、RI置0或TI置1

    正确答案:A

  • 第5题:

    判断下列说法正确的有()。

    • A、串行口通讯的第9数据位的功能可由用户定义。
    • B、发送数据的第9数据位的内容在SCON寄存器的TB8位中预先准备好的。
    • C、串行通讯帧发送时,指令把TB8位的状态送入发送SBUF中。
    • D、串行通讯接收到的第9位数据送SCON寄存器的RB8中保存。

    正确答案:A,B,D

  • 第6题:

    SCON寄存器中的RB8位表示()

    • A、多机控制位
    • B、串行口接收允许控制位
    • C、第9位发送数据
    • D、多机通信时收到的第9位数据

    正确答案:D

  • 第7题:

    AT89S51单片机串行口接收/发送数据缓冲器都用SBUF,如果同时接收/发送数据时,是否会发生冲突?为什么?


    正确答案:不会发生冲突的。串口通信中,有两个缓冲寄存器SBUF,一个是发送寄存器,一个是接收寄存器,这两个寄存器在物理结构上是完全独立的。它们都是字节寻址的寄存器,字节地址均为99H。这个重叠的地址靠读/写指令区分:串行发送时,CPU向SBUF写入数据,此时99H表示发送SBUF;串行接收时,CPU从SBUF读出数据,此时99H表示接收SBUF。

  • 第8题:

    串行口数据缓冲器SBUF是可以直接寻址的()。


    正确答案:专用寄存器

  • 第9题:

    MCS—51单片机串行口发送/接收中断源的工作过程是:当串行口接收或发送完一帧数据时,将SCON中的()向CPU申请中断。

    • A、RI或TI置1
    • B、RI或TI置0
    • C、RI置1或TI置0
    • D、RI置0或TI置1

    正确答案:A

  • 第10题:

    串行口的发送缓冲器和接收缓冲器只有1个单元地址,但实际上它们是两个不同的寄存器。


    正确答案:正确

  • 第11题:

    SCON寄存器中的TI位表示()

    • A、发送中断标志
    • B、串行口接收允许控制位
    • C、第9位发送数据
    • D、多机通信时收到的第9位数据

    正确答案:A

  • 第12题:

    通过串行口发送或接收数据时,在程序中应使用()

    • A、MOV指令
    • B、MOVX指令
    • C、MOVC指令
    • D、SWAP指令

    正确答案:A

  • 第13题:

    SCON的中文含义是()。

    A串行接口

    B串行口控制寄存器

    CRS-232接口

    D串行口数据缓冲器


    正确答案:B

  • 第14题:

    全双工网卡是指可以同时进行发送数据和接收数据两种操作的网卡。


    正确答案:正确

  • 第15题:

    串行口的控制寄存器SCON中,REN的作用是()。

    • A、接收中断请求标志位
    • B、发送中断请求标志位
    • C、串行口允许接收位
    • D、地址/数据位

    正确答案:C

  • 第16题:

    单片机串行口不管采用哪种工作方式,都是由RXD端发送数据TXD端接收数据的。


    正确答案:错误

  • 第17题:

    SBUF的中文含义是()。

    • A、串行接口
    • B、串行口控制寄存器
    • C、RS-232接口
    • D、串行数据缓冲器

    正确答案:D

  • 第18题:

    串行口数据寄存器SBUF有什么特点?


    正确答案:发送数据寄存器和接收数据寄存器合起用一个特殊功能寄存器SBUF(串行口数据寄存器),执行MOV SBUF,A发送时为发送数据寄存器,执行MOV A, SBUF接收时为接收数据寄存器。

  • 第19题:

    SCON寄存器中的REN位表示()

    • A、多机控制位
    • B、串行口接收允许控制位
    • C、第9位发送数据
    • D、多机通信时收到的第9位数据

    正确答案:B

  • 第20题:

    简述串行口接收和发送数据的过程。


    正确答案: 以方式一为例。发送:数据位由TXT端输出,发送1帧信息为10为,当CPU执行1条数据写发送缓冲器SBUF的指令,就启动发送。发送开始时,内部发送控制信号/SEND变为有效,将起始位想TXD输出,此后,每经过1个TX时钟周期,便产生1个移位脉冲,并由TXD输出1个数据位。
    8位数据位全部完毕后,置1中断标志位TI,然后/SEND信号失效。接收:当检测到起始位的负跳变时,则开始接收。接受时,定时控制信号有2种,一种是位检测器采样脉冲,它的频率是RX时钟的16倍。
    也就是在1位数据期间,有16个采样脉冲,以波特率的16倍的速率采样RXD引脚状态,当采样到RXD端从1到0的跳变时就启动检测器,接收的值是3次连续采样,取其中2次相同的值,以确认是否是真正的起始位的开始,这样能较好地消除干扰引起的影响,以保证可靠无误的开始接受数据。

  • 第21题:

    8×51的串行口是通过()引脚进行数据传输的?

    • A、R×D引脚接收数据
    • B、T×D引脚接收数据
    • C、R×D发送数据
    • D、以上皆非

    正确答案:A

  • 第22题:

    由于MCS-51单片机的串行口的数据发送和接收缓冲器都是SBUF,所以其串行口不能同时发送和接收数据,即不是全双工的串行口。


    正确答案:错误

  • 第23题:

    在串行口的控制寄存器SCON中,REN的作用是()

    • A、接收中断请求标志位
    • B、发送中断请求标志位
    • C、串行口允许接收位
    • D、地址/数据位

    正确答案:C

  • 第24题:

    判断题
    标准串行口用发送数据寄存器和接收数据寄存器传送数据
    A

    B


    正确答案:
    解析: 暂无解析